US Sanctions in Venezuela - Using AIS and Network Analysis to Visualize Impact with Sofia Vargas 28.05.2020 28:02
C4ADS analyst Sofia Vargas is mapping out and analyzing ships' behavior in and near the Venezuelan Exclusive Economic Zone following U.S. sanctions on the Venezuelan oil sector. By fusing AIS data, vessel identifier data, and corporate ownership information, C4ADS is harnessing publicly available information to monitor risks posed by sanctions in the maritime domain. Iran's Illicit LPG Ecosystem with Evan Accardi 22.05.2020 50:16
Fusing satellite imagery, AIS, and vessel data, C4ADS Analyst Evan Accardi is mapping commercial facilitators of Iran's illicit LPG trade. He shows that arriving at entity-level identifications of actors involved in maritime sanctions evasion, even those employing sophisticated obfuscatory behavior, is possible with publicly available data.
